Output 91850079050d619832a117304ef76927393bf798f74ce1ac10d5a28b4c52883a:5

value
554793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84d8bd56902a4be439469ff9ac36d45297e9b0a1 OP_EQUAL
address
3DoSmCNjEAhGu5So62qpxQGgQGWUW5cvdG
transaction
91850079050d619832a117304ef76927393bf798f74ce1ac10d5a28b4c52883a
spent
true